Bit Banged Optical UART (Third UART)
As shown in Figure 15, the 71M6543 can also be configured to drive the optical UART with a DIO signal
in a bit banged configuration. When control bit OPT_BB (I/O RAM 0x2022[0]) is set, the optical port is
driven by DIO5 and the SEGDIO5 pin is driven by UART1_TX. This configuration is typically used when
the two dedicated UARTs must be connected to high speed clients and a slower optical UART is
permissible.

2.5.10 Digital I/O and LCD Segment Drivers
2.5.10.1 General Information
The 71M6543 combines most DIO pins with LCD segment drivers. Each SEG/DIO pin can be configured
as a DIO pin or as a segment driver pin (SEG).
On reset or power-up, all DIO pins are DIO inputs (except for SEGDIO0-15, see caution note below) until
they are configured as desired under MPU control. The pin function can be configured by the I/O RAM
registers LCD_MAPn (0x2405 – 0x240B). Setting the bit corresponding to the pin in LCD_MAPn to 1
configures the pin for LCD, setting LCD_MAPn to 0 configures it for DIO.
